Quick commands are valid for 10 seconds of no activity, unless otherwise stated.
CHANGE PARTITION: [#] [0]
[#] [0] [CODE] [0], [1], [2], or [9]
OMNI-KP and OMNI-KP-US keypads display "EC" (enter code) after pressing #0, then display "CP"
(change partition) after entering the user code.
NOTE: #0 is available to authority level 1 and 2 users only.
QUICK ARMING: # 1
If programmed, Quick Arming will be permitted. Quick Arming allows arming the system without
entry of a user code, and reports as user F or 128 if CID reporting is being used. Quick Arming has not
been evaluated by UL.
NOTE: The system must be in Ready mode. A user code is required to disarm the system. Options
include:
[STAY] [#] [1]
[INSTANT] [#] [1]
[STAY][INSTANT] [#] [1]
QUICK FORCED ARMING: # 2
If programmed, then Quick Forced Arming will be permitted. Quick Forced Arming allows arming the
system without entry of a user code, and bypasses any bypassable zones that are not ready. It reports
as user F or 127 if CID reporting is being used. Quick Forced Arming has not been evaluated by UL.
NOTE: Bypassed zones will include all of the individual points assigned to the zone. A user code is
required to disarm.
SET TIME: # 3
Pressing [#] [3] sets the time of the system clock. If a user code is required to set the time, then enter:
[#] + [3] + USER NO. + HOUR + MINUTE + MONTH + DAY + YEAR + CRYSTAL ADJUST

# 58
Lets the user modify the current pager phone number.
Note: Once the number is changed, pager reports will go to that number
until the number is changed again using the #58 command.
#6
The LCD keypad will display current state and provide option to toggle the
current state. The LED pads will simply toggle the chime state and beep
once to indicate the state has changed.
#7 [Code] [user
Allows the assignment of user codes to multiple partitions. User with
no.] [1, 2, or 4]
authority of 1 or 2 is required to enter this mode. This allows users to be
(4 = enable
enabled in both partitions (1 and 2) and also enables the user for paging
paging)
(4).
#8
Toggle state of pager. Works same as chime. For user open/close only.
#9
Starts remote connect sequence with PC downloader.
